Roger Allen Inuvik Twin Lakes

Thank you, Mr. Chairman. Yes, we certainly enjoyed our trip to Aklavik to discuss their willingness to work not only with ourselves but also with other ministries to put their curling rink into the capital plan. Just to talk a bit about the concept here. They want to also include a small business entity into the curling rink so they have a method of supporting it. They talked about a small restaurant facility that would be included in the conceptual designs so they could have a dual purpose here. It is very encouraging, but the question I guess is how do we put this into the capital plan? I will ask Mr. Murray to assist me in explaining that a little further. Thank you.

Murray

Thank you, Mr. Chairman. We are just now embarking on the process of developing the capital plan for the next several years. That capital plan will cover all the various projects in the communities. Our staff over the next several months, between now and June, will be expected to visit with each community, work with the community to set those priorities and then build that into the capital plan for the future. As of today, there is no money that I am aware of for the curling rink in the plan at this point in time, but that may be something that can be worked in.
